A Red Flag Warning means that critical fire weather conditions are either occurring now, or will shortly. A combination of strong winds, low relative humidity, and warm temperatures can contribute to extreme fire behavior.
RED FLAG WARNING IN EFFECT TODAY ACROSS SOUTHWEST TO SOUTH CENTRAL SOUTH DAKOTA... .Very warm temperatures will continue this afternoon along with dry and gusty west to southwest winds. Across southwest to south- central South Dakota, minimum relative humidities this afternoon will be in the teens. This will continue to produce critical fire weather conditions across southwest and south central South Dakota this afternoon. * AFFECTED AREA...Fire Weather Zones 322 Fall River County Area, 325 Custer County Plains, 326 Pine Ridge Area, 332 Badlands Area, 333 Bennett County Area, 334 Mellette and Todd Counties and 335 Tripp County. * WINDS...West 15 to 25 mph with gusts up to 35 mph. * RELATIVE HUMIDITY...As low as 15 percent. * IMPACTS...The combination of gusty winds and low relative humidity would produce critical fire weather conditions.
